Day 2; Tarangire National Park
We will pick you up from your lodge early morning and take you to an extraordinary national park! Tarangire National Park is famous for its diverse landscape with nine different vegetation zones. The park is particularly known for the abundance of ancient baobab trees (the largest trees on the continent), which fill the landscape and dwarf the animals next to them.
The park's river is iconic, and the area is full of wildlife, ranging from a large variety of birds to lions, leopards, zebras, giraffes, buffaloes, antelopes, and, of course, elephants. The park has the largest concentration of elephants in the whole country and provides unique chances to observe the interaction between elephant families.

Day 4; Serengeti National Park
You'll start the day with a sunrise viewing. Then, after breakfast, you'll proceed with a game drive until lunch. You will be amazed by the endless plains filled with acacia trees, birds, mammals, and big cats. The Serengeti is home to the annual Great Migration, when millions of wildebeest, hundreds of thousands of zebras, and all kinds of antelopes, including impalas and Thomson's gazelles, pass through the area towards the Maasai Mara. As for hyenas and big cats, it is the place of choice to look out for lions, cheetahs, and leopards. Many television scenes of the famous river crossings have been filmed here in the park.

Day 5; Ngorongoro Crater
Today, you will wake up early. After breakfast, you will drive towards the Ngorongoro Crater, a beautiful area. You will descend into the incredible Ngorongoro Crater.
The Ngorongoro Crater is the largest intact crater in the world. The crater is home to an estimated 30,000 large mammals! Due to its natural borders, wildlife is abundant throughout the conservation area. Chances are excellent to see the Big Five, hyenas, zebras, and elephants, to name a few.
